@phoenixtypewriter21363 жыл бұрын
Machine oil ? most parts on typewriters do not need oil, or if any, just a dusting of the lightest possible Some gun oil could be used on the carriage bearings and other contact points, but the type bar/basket pivots should have any thing that resembles oil, unless maybe you use high compressed air and blow out excess. @bwhog5 ай бұрын
I personally use clock oil and only put it here it's needed like pivots and sliding surfaces and just a small drop to each spot, usually. (Over oiling is how you get machines full of dirt and gummed up levers.) For bearings, I usually prefer grease because it stays in place better. But again, a little can go a long way.

@bwhog5 ай бұрын
@@brookanderson404 The film of WD40 is to protect the keys and such from splashes of cleaner. Notice that it only goes on what he isn't cleaning and not onto the inner workings. He doesn't use it to lube the machine, which is what most people misunderstand about it. So what he puts on is for it's intended purpose and then he wipes all the WD40 off when he's done cleaning. He's just using ordinary lacquer thinner for his cleaning. Other people use mineral spirits, which requires the same precautions and maybe even more because it *will* harm the paint. Both basically dry residue free.
